    We came in for brunch on a Saturday and the crowd was not too crazy which was nice. They have a few outdoor seating in the front as well as a spacious dining area inside. You can grab a menu and seat yourself. When you're ready to order, you walk up to the bar to put in your order. Don't forget to take note of your table number to let them know where you're sitting. We ordered the honey chicken biscuit, brisket hash, and eggs benedict. The brisket hash dish was rich and filling. It had a good amount of meat and was flavorful. The honey chicken biscuit was also nice. The biscuit was moist and the chicken was fried perfectly. We didn't like that the syrup ran into the fried potatoes though. The star dish was the eggs benedict.The perfectly poached eggs were plated on top of big pieces of ham that sat on top of avocado toasts. They have a variety of drinks as well. I opted for a banana cold foam matcha and it was so good. I personally wasn't too fond of the coffee drinks that I got to sample from my family members. I found the coffee too acidic, but I would definitely get the matcha latte again. Cool place to grab a nice breakfast/brunch before heading off to our cruise!

    Leeland house is a chic and welcoming place nestled in the neighborhood. Everyone was friendly and welcoming upon our entry and the decor was crisp and inviting. They have an open seating and bar ordering system which some people balk at but, it was easy and more efficient than waiting for someone to come take your order. Our family of six was easily accommodated and instantly serviced with drinks. We ordered a variety of dishes and everyone left completely clean plates which anyone with kids knows is a miracle alone! The gravy for the biscuits and gravy is one of the most unique and tasty ones I have had with its andouille sausage twist. Be sure to add brisket for the true chef's kiss experience. Overall, very tasty and cool vibe place. Definitely recommend for anyone visiting Galveston.

    It was the start of a holiday weekend, so we anticipated having to wait to get in. It was great…read morethat they take your phone number and text you when your table is ready, as we were able to stroll around the neighborhood while we were waiting. The interior of the restaurant is small, but interesting. The pizza making portion of their kitchen is visible from the tables, so you can watch them as they make the pizzas. Our waiter was super friendly, and the service was excellent. We started off our meal with the fried mushroom appetizer. Usually, when you order fried mushrooms, you get an entire mushroom dipped in breading and fried. Here the mushrooms are chopped into chunks before breading and frying. It came with both marinara and ranch for dipping sauces. We loved having the smaller chunks, because if you've ever eaten fried mushrooms, you know that when you bite into them , the juice can sear your mouth. By using smaller chunks, it was much easier to eat, especially when piping hot. We were surprised that they didn't carry banana peppers as a topping for pizzas, but other than that, our pizza was fabulous! We deliberately bought a larger pizza than we needed, because we were looking for leftovers. The pizza heated up well the next day! We would highly recommend visiting Mama Teresa's!
